Transaction 81582a4039a78d7786c05f49962733318cc0072a29a70242e5ded88f2b356b51
2 Input
2 Outputs
- 81582a4039a78d7786c05f49962733318cc0072a29a70242e5ded88f2b356b51:0
- 81582a4039a78d7786c05f49962733318cc0072a29a70242e5ded88f2b356b51:1
value 760000000
address 3MForezcpZXK28xDCXqoxEX64uCPhHu5qk
value 6835928
address 1B6rJ6ZKfZmkqMyBGe5KR27oWkEbQdNM7P